Lonnie Dale Routh, who resided near Stigler, Oklahoma, passed away Thursday, May 27, 2021, at his home. He was born November 5, 1960, in Cedar County, Missouri, to the late Noble A. Routh and Mable Daniels Routh. He was 60 years old.

Dale was a mechanic and also worked in construction. He loved to fish and hunt. He also loved riding go-karts, watching Nascar Racing, and collecting guns. He loved his family very much and will be missed by everyone who knew him.

He is survived by his wife of 27 years, Penny (Hovis) Routh; three daughters, Chrysta Shelley and husband Kyle of Missouri, Renee Ingram of Oklahoma City, and Jamie Ingram of Arkansas; a son, Justin Liebes of Blackwell, Oklahoma; two sisters, Vickie Clifford and husband Marty of Bridge Creek, Oklahoma and Mitzi Whitehead and husband David of Ohio; one brother, Ronnie Routh and wife Vicke of Edmond, Oklahoma; twelve grandchildren and four great-grandchildren.
